Pakistan won its semi-final match against Bangladesh by 11 runs on Thursday night after stumbling (read: collapsing) to 135-8 in the Asia Cup Super Four in Dubai.

And somehow, SOMEHOW, with that nervy win, the Green Shirts booked a final date with archrivals India for the first time in the tournament’s 17 editions.
